What is a Window Treatment Specialist?
A window treatment specialist is a professional dedicated to creating, selecting, and setting up numerous kinds of window treatments. These might consist of curtains, draperies, blinds, tones, and shutters. With knowledge in both aesthetic style and functional requirements, these experts comprehend how different products and styles can influence a space's overall ambiance, personal privacy, light control, and energy performance.

Typical Types of Window Treatments
When dealing with a window treatment specialist, clients will likely come across the following common kinds of treatments:
Type
Description
Blinds
Horizontal or vertical slats that control light and privacy.
Shades
Material or vinyl treatments that can be brought up or down, supplying varying levels of opacity.
Draperies
Floor-length curtains that can include sophistication and heat to any room.
Shutters
Strong panels set up on the window frame, providing robust light control and design.
Drapes
Light-weight material panels that frame windows without the bulk of drapery.
